Lateraland Penetrating Damp

Problems normally occur where external ground levels are higher than existing damp-courses and internal floor levels, and where damp internal concrete floors are not isolated from existing masonry walls. A common occurrence with split-level homes on sloping building sites with internal supporting walls having "fill" higher on one side of the wall than the other. Basements commonly exhibit moisture contamination permeating through the walls from the external higher soil levels. Surface salt deposits would also be apparent.

As with Rising damp similar symptoms are visible:

  • Blistering
  • Salt-ridden and flaky paint
  • White salt powdered residue
  • Powdery disintegrating mortar and plaster
  • Rotting timber skirting-boards and door-frames

Other common causes of- lateral or penetrating damp is:

  • Internal plumbing leaks
  • Shower bases
  • Garden sprinklers
  • Flower boxes
  • Poor storm water drainage
  • Leaking down-pipes or gutters
